Casa Augusta Hotel - Lagos
37.10214, -8.67198Casa Augusta Hotel Lagos is situated in the Lagos City Center district, around a 5-minute walk from Church of Santa Maria and features 9 rooms with views of the sea. To keep fit, a golf course provided for guests at the guest house.
Location
Located 0.2 miles from Fortress of Ponta da Bandeira, the Casa Augusta is just near ProPuttingGarden. Dona Ana Beach is 18 minutes' stroll from the hotel, while Portas de Portugal - Mercado bus stop is approximately 10 minutes' walk away. Praia do Camilo Public Beach is a mere 0.9 miles away, and Lagos is situated just a minute's drive from this property.
For those traveling from afar, Portimao airport is 25 minutes' drive away.
Rooms
The rooms at the Casa Augusta Lagos feature a writing table, along with sound-proofed windows for guests' convenience. Bathroom essentials include a separate toilet and a shower, and such comforts as hairdryers and towels.
